Faster demolition of concrete buildings with less dust and noise

Atlas Copco Construction Tools

Published on

The Swedish company Atlas Copco Construction Tools is launching three new crushers with hydraulic rotation. Earlier models had free rotation through 360Ý. Hydraulic rotation ensures high precision, especially when the carrier has a long boom and is working vertically. The new design speeds up demolition work, and reduces carrier wear.

Ultra thin copper strip technology cuts car heater costs by a third

Outokumpu Copper Strip AB

Published on

The use of ultra-thin copper strip technology is allowing automotive manufacturers to produce stronger, lighter and less costly vehicle heating systems. Called Compact Core, the technology saves up to 30% of automotive heat exchanger material costs by allowing extremely thin and rigid air fins to be manufactured.

New high power system extends applications for ultrasonic plastics assembly

Dukane Ultrasonics

Published on

The first 40 KHz ultrasonic plastics assembly system to offer 1000 watts of power has been introduced by Dukane Ultrasonics. The increased power of the new system will allow use of ultrasonic technology for larger components that require the delicate handling afforded by the 40KHz frequency, the manufacturer states.

Worlds toughest sail race means baptism by fire for new battery

Optima Batteries AB

Published on

The Whitbread Round the World Race is the world’s toughest ocean sailing race. Safety requirements are strict, not least when it comes to the all-important electric power supply. The batteries mustn’t weigh more than 280 kilos and must have a high capacity. Short charging time, versatile mounting, high resistance to vibrations, impacts, blows and temperature variations are other important requirements. After thorough tests, the crews of the Swedish W60 boats, EF Education and EF Language, and of the Norwegian Kvaerner boat, chose the standard Yellow Top battery from Optima batteries.
